enjoy a challenge
Frequency: 7.313.1 per million words
to find pleasure in a challenging situation

Examples (10)
- She's the kind of person who really enjoys a challenge at work.
- He truly enjoyed the challenge of learning a new language from scratch.
- I think you will enjoy the challenge of leading this new project.
- As a competitive swimmer, I always enjoy a good challenge from my opponents.
- To grow as an artist, you must learn to enjoy a creative challenge.
- While the marathon was tough, I can honestly say I enjoyed the physical challenge.
- Do you enjoy a mental challenge like solving complex puzzles?
- They wouldn't have taken the job if they didn't enjoy a challenge.
- He has always enjoyed the intellectual challenge that comes with scientific research.
- We are looking for candidates who enjoy a fast-paced challenge and can think on their feet.
